WebMOSFET, short for Metal-Oxide-Semiconductor Field-Effect Transistor, is a field-effect transistor that can be widely used in analog circuits and digital circuits. MOSFETs can be divided into N-channel type with the majority of electrons and P-channel type with the majority of holes according to their "channel" polarity.
